Had a great catchup with the one and only @bec_chappell on Friday, in Hobart for a Business Chicks conference. It had been on the cards to meet, so we did on Friday lunchtime.

Bec and I chatted many times after meeting through @janinegarner 's Elevate, so it was lovely to finally meet in person. Lots to chat about and meeting people you may not have is a good thing to emerge from our forced Zoom lives. 

We had some food and nice wine at @franklinwharf - a fairly new venue right on Hobart's beautiful waterfront. The service was great, such accommodating and friendly staff who swapped out a dish for another at no charge because it just wasn't right. Here's a brief overview:

Photos are
🍽 Bec toasting to life, adventure and our food
🍽 Me and Bec - check out that view! We're just metres from the waterline.
🍽 Charred Octopus - peperonata | lemon labne | Nduja - both our favourite dish of the day
🍽 Roast Heirloom Beets - smoked almond purée |
hazelnuts | apple balsamic - also delicious
🍽 Ceviche | white fish | cucumber | black lime | horseradish | finger lime - was very fishy for a ceviche and lacked balance. I can't recall the name of the fish, but it didn't work and was kindly swapped for ...
🍽 Chicken Liver Parfait - marinated cherries |
mustard fruits | brioche - very tasty.

We also enjoyed sparkling rosé and lovely whites with lunch. Mine was a Glaetzer Dixon Uberblanc - lovely. Didn't note the details of the others... oops.

I'll happily go back to Franklin Wharf and explore more from that menu!

And Bec, safe travels ✈️.

After four days away I was craving home-made, light and fresh food. I took some home made chicken stock out of the freezer and also thawed a chicken breast, which I poached.  Brought the broth to a simmer, then added broccoli, shredded carrot and some poached chicken breast. Topped it with chilli and it was just what the doctor ordered. Yum! Restorative food rocks.
